Challenges in manually coordinating deliveries and unloadings
In many companies, coordinating deliveries is still a manual process: carriers make phone calls, suppliers send emails, and warehouse employees keep records in Excel or even on paper. At first glance, such a system seems simple, but in practice it causes a number of problems:
- Opacity of terms – Overlaps often occur when multiple deliveries to the same ramp are announced at the same time.
- Delays and queues – carriers are waiting for unloading, which extends delivery times and creates unnecessary costs.
- High dependence on individuals – if the responsible person is absent, information is lost or delayed.
- Greater possibility of errors – Manual data entry leads to incorrect records, forgotten announcements or poor communication with suppliers.
- Poor resource utilization – employees and equipment are not optimally deployed because there is no comprehensive overview of upcoming deliveries.
This way of working is particularly problematic for companies that receive a large number of deliveries daily. As the number of trucks increases, manual coordination becomes practically unmanageable.
What does delivery notification automation mean?
Automation of delivery announcements means that classic telephone or email communication is replaced with a digital system that enables easy and transparent appointment bookingInstead of employees manually coordinating the arrival of trucks, this is done by a web application that acts as a central calendar for all parties involved.
Key features of automation:
- Standalone announcements – suppliers and carriers enter the delivery date themselves via the application.
- Central calendar – all appointments are collected in one place, which prevents duplication or incorrect agreements.
- Flexibility – the system allows restrictions (e.g. a maximum of two unloading ramps at a time) and automatically blocks already occupied times.
- Notification and confirmations – all parties receive automatic notifications about confirmation or changes to the appointment.
- Integration with other processes – delivery data can be linked to ERP systems, warehouse records or production plans.
This way, the company gains transparency, efficiency and less administrative work, while reducing the risk of errors.

How the delivery and unloading announcement system works in practice
The digital delivery notification system is designed to be easy to use and yet powerful enough to cover the various needs of companies.
1. Entering an appointment
The supplier or carrier logs into the app and selects a free delivery time. The system shows them the available hours and ramps that are still free.
2. Automatic confirmation
Once the appointment is booked, the system automatically confirms the application and notifies both the supplier and the warehouse manager. If the appointment is not available, the application offers alternative options.
3. Employee review
Warehouse employees have access to a central calendar where they can see all announcements in real time, allowing them to allocate forklifts, personnel, and equipment in a timely manner.
4. Notification and changes
If there is a change in the appointment, the app automatically sends notifications to everyone involved. This way, the information is always up-to-date, without additional calls or emails.
5. Integration with other systems
Delivery data can be linked to an ERP system or warehouse records, giving the company a complete overview – from the order to the actual receipt of the goods.
The result is a smooth and predictable process where everyone knows what is happening and when.
Use case: a typical day in a warehouse before and after digitization
Before digitalization
On Monday morning, several trucks arrive at the warehouse at the same time. Drivers call to check when they can be unloaded. A line is already forming at the ramp, and employees are not sure which delivery is the priority. Some trucks wait for hours, while warehouse workers rush to finish tasks they have already started. Stress is high, and there is minimal oversight of the situation.
After digitization
All suppliers have booked their appointments in advance via the app. Drivers arrive at the agreed times, where a free ramp awaits them. Warehouse workers know exactly which delivery is coming and are ready with a forklift and staff on time. There is no unnecessary waiting, work runs smoothly, and everyone has a clear overview of the day's schedule.
Result:
- shorter unloading times,
- less confusion,
- less burden on employees,
- more satisfied suppliers and carriers.
Steps to deploy the solution in your company
The transition from manual to digital delivery coordination may seem challenging at first, but the implementation process can be gradual and transparent. The key is good preparation and involvement of all stakeholders.
1. Analysis of the existing process
First, it is necessary to assess how announcements and unloadings are currently carried out: who receives the information, where the bottlenecks occur, how much time employees spend on administration. Such an overview shows where digitalization brought the most benefit.
2. Choosing the right digital solution
There are various applications and systems on the market – from generic to custom solutions. A company must choose the one that best fits their processes, warehouse size and delivery volume.
3. Pilot implementation
It is recommended to first implement the system on a smaller scale – for example, on one ramp or for a specific type of delivery. This allows the company to test the functionality and troubleshoot any potential issues.
4. Involving employees and partners
It is crucial that warehouse employees, as well as suppliers and carriers, are involved from the start. Clear instructions and training help the system to be implemented quickly.
5. Gradual expansion
Once the pilot is successful, the solution will be gradually expanded to all warehouse processes. At this stage, the system can also be connected to other applications, such as ERP or production planning.

The future of warehouse digitalization: connection with IoT and artificial intelligence
Digitalization of warehouse processes is just the first step in a broader transformation of logistics. The future brings an even closer connection with IoT (Internet of Things) and artificial intelligence (AI), which will further optimize work in warehouses.
IoT – smart devices in the warehouse
Sensors and smart devices allow for monitoring free ramps, measuring unloading times, detecting the occupancy of warehouse spaces, and even tracking the temperature of sensitive goods. All of this information is automatically linked to delivery announcements, enabling even more accurate planning.
Artificial Intelligence – Forecasting and Optimization
AI systems can predict traffic peaks based on historical data, suggest optimal delivery times, and even automatically allocate resources (employees, forklifts, equipment) to reduce the risk of congestion and increase efficiency.
Connection to the wider supply chain
Digitalized warehouse processes will become part of an integrated supply chain, where order, production, and transportation data are linked in real time. This will allow the company to react more quickly to changes in demand and optimize overall logistics costs.
The future therefore brings not only the automation of announcements, but also smart warehouses, where processes will be almost completely autonomous and supported by data analytics.
